Transaction 641c60634949fe8af1c3365a896db765f6ff000b5a984c36b76592002f05f3c3
1 Input
2 Outputs
- 641c60634949fe8af1c3365a896db765f6ff000b5a984c36b76592002f05f3c3:0
- 641c60634949fe8af1c3365a896db765f6ff000b5a984c36b76592002f05f3c3:1
value 37500000
address 1316eHQNXK6qaLQ5jBfYbjoD4eHkKPpzoy
value 462494400
address 1ETPtWDx56fz8zqhtBKhcJ7yzWaYmJ92xh